Output 38e21ec786640c4375f68a29ad54c30e7cca4027a23b043d161ee39e785ecf46:3

value
28471000
script pubkey
OP_0 OP_PUSHBYTES_20 0ff08a5875d616b1a71b437da3c4aebc66c88cfa
address
ltc1qplcg5kr46cttrfcmgd76839wh3nv3r867t8zua
transaction
38e21ec786640c4375f68a29ad54c30e7cca4027a23b043d161ee39e785ecf46
spent
true